The surface micro grinding of Sanluo Precision uses extremely small abrasive grains to grind the protruding parts of the material surface to obtain an ultra-smooth surface. The abrasive grain size is W0.5-W40 with a particle size of 0.5-40μm, and the materials include alumina, silicon carbide and diamond. The grinding methods include surface grinding, cylindrical grinding, internal grinding, spherical grinding and free-form surface grinding. The grinding pressure adjustment range is 0.01-0.5MPa, low pressure will not damage the surface, and uniform pressure ensures surface consistency. The grinding speed is 10-100m/min, and the speed, pressure and abrasive grain size are used in combination. The surface roughness is Ra0.01-0.1μm, and Ra<0.01μm is called mirror finish. The flatness is 0.001mm, the parallelism is 0.002mm, and the roundness is 0.001mm.

Ceramic Surface Grinding and Polishing Technology
Sanluo Precision's processing plant has professional ceramic micro grinding and polishing processes: ceramic materials (alumina, zirconia, silicon nitride, silicon carbide) with a hardness of HV1500-3000; rough grinding with W20/W40 abrasives to remove excess material, with a flatness of <0.01mm and a roughness of Ra0.4-0.8μm; finish grinding with W7/W14 abrasives to improve accuracy, with a flatness of 0.003mm and a roughness of Ra0.1-0.2μm; polishing with W1.5-W3.5 abrasives for mirror effect, with a flatness of 0.001mm and a roughness of Ra0.01-0.05μm; ultra-precision polishing with W0.5 abrasives or chemical mechanical polishing (CMP), with a roughness of Ra<0.01μm close to atomic-level smoothness.
Grinding Equipment Capacity
As a professional manufacturer of surface micro grinding, we are equipped with advanced equipment: surface grinding machine with a flatness of 0.0001mm and a machining thickness of 0.1-50mm; cylindrical grinding machine with a grinding diameter of φ0.5-100mm, a roundness of ≤0.001mm and a surface Ra≤0.05μm; internal grinding machine with a hole diameter of φ2-100mm and a depth-diameter ratio of ≥3:1; spherical grinding machine with a spherical radius of ≤100mm and a sphericity of 0.005mm; CNC grinding machine with a profile accuracy of ±0.002mm; ultrasonic grinding to improve the machining efficiency of hard and brittle materials. The application fields are extensive: optical components (lenses, prisms with surface Ra<0.01μm, surface accuracy λ/10, reflectors with flatness λ/20), ceramic parts (alumina substrates with flatness 0.001mm, zirconia bushings with roundness 0.002mm), precision bearings (ceramic balls with sphericity 0.0005mm), medical implants (sphericity 0.005mm, all-ceramic crowns with smooth and wear-resistant performance).
